#18b460 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#18b460 is composed of 9.4% red, 70.6%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 46.7% yellow and 29.4% black. It has a hue angle of 147.7 degrees, a saturation of 76.5% and a lightness of 40%. #18b460 color hex could be obtained by blending #30ffc0 with #006900. Closest websafe color is: #00cc66.

#18b460 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#18b460 has RGB values of R:24, G:180, B:96 and CMYK values of C:0.87, M:0, Y:0.47,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 1619040.
